London considers pay-per-mile scheme for motorists
from FT News in Focus
Efforts to combat congestion in London have had the perverse effect of increasing pollution as road changes to help cyclists and pedestrians have slowed the average speeds of motor vehicles. Will a proposed scheme to charge motorists per mile solve the problem? Barney Thompson puts the question to the FT's transport correspondent Robert Wright. Hosted on Acast.
